"Arrested Development" and "Lego Batman" star Will Arnett returns for a second season of the Netflix dramedy series "Flaked," for which an official trailer has just been released.

Arnett, who also created the show with writer Mark Chappell (The Increasingly Poor Decisions of Todd Margaret), plays 'Chip,' a recovering alcoholic who has embraced the breezy beach community of Venice, California as his new home base.

Season Two finds Chip feeling the repercussions of his actions from last season. Once again trying to piece his life back together, he calls on his Venice buddies, Dennis (David Sullivan) and Cooler (George Basil), for help as he tries to win back his girlfriend, London (Ruth Kearney).

Co-starring Lenora Crichlow and Shawn Hatosy, "Flaked: Season 2" will be released on Friday, June 2nd.

synopsis:
Chip returns to Venice after a short exile and finds that he is persona non grata. No store, no friends, not even a guest house to live in, it's a long road back to the way things were.
